Michel Bettane: Big color, very rich body, cooked nose, high alcohol content evident, very powerful, not the style I like, but impressive. 16.5
Thierry Desseauve: Chocolate and black-fruit aromas, richness, ripe tannins, length, and elegance in a very powerful style: intense. 17
Michael Schuster: Ripe-fruited to smell; elegantly balanced second wine, firmly tannic, but without asperity, and with nice length across the palate, and to finish. The alcohol is still a little present on the firm, warm aftertaste. 2020–30. 15.5
